I do fish while crusing. There are places along the way that I know will hold fish. I often slow and troll by a hot spot or two.

I also stop and fish a few pinicles on the high or low tide Usually just a 30 min stop.

I use spinning reels for salmon and Penn 33o GTI levelwind for the Halibut,Ling cod *and rock fish. I use* electramate electric winder's for the penn reels so I can fish in depths up to 600 ft with a pound of lead on the line and still reel in and not take all day doing it.

I'm not a trophy keeper at all. I eat everything I catch and always, always cook fish on board every time I go out. If it's not fin fish it's shell fish I'm just fortunate to live where there truly is a bounty from the sea.* I need to say I have eaten some pretty strange fish.

This one we didn't cook on the boat but did have it smoked. The best smoked wolf eel I ever had.

If I catch a cod I usually make a fishermans Brewis. It is a triditional From dish Newfoundland* made from hard tac*cod and salt pork.
